你查询的IP:[123.52.3.196]  地理位置:中国–河南–郑州

最新查询121.51.157.119 117.75.197.111 122.112.187.199 222.128.13.0 121.56.231.100 202.112.107.244 123.112.195.22 124.196.126.169 166.111.145.215 123.52.3.196 203.89.166.88 61.236.40.98 202.38.128.49 198.17.7.99 202.38.146.178 221.199.128.142 122.119.83.89 58.154.161.113 123.96.122.57 123.49.128.7 120.72.128.121 202.131.48.92 210.14.112.40 124.28.192.63 202.85.208.210 122.248.48.189 117.112.203.13 202.49.176.152 120.72.128.124 221.176.196.125 203.223.43.18